French Paragliding Championship

10 May, 2009

The French paragliding Championship will take place in the Louron Valley, Hautes Pyrenees, from 21 – 28 June 2009. Reigning champions Simon Issenhut and female World Champion Elisa Houdry will join 118 of France’s other top competitors, along with 20 high level pilots from other nations, to compete against the beautiful backdrop of the Pyrenees, landing in the field next to Lac de Genos, where a fun and lively atmosphere cannot fail to prevail.

An environmentally clean event is promised, competitors using cable cars to get to launch, and recycling bins and dry toilets will be in place at take off and at competition headquarters. An exhibition and conference on birds of prey will be set up in support of the French bird protection league (LPO), and wheelchair flying demonstrations on the Wednesday and Thursday aim to promote flying for those with disabilities.
